Dvabzu (დვაბზუ) is a village in the Guria region, 6 km east from region capital Ozurgeti. The village is known for its beautiful landscape and agriculture.

Gurians speak much more quickly than average Georgians from other regions, so it is more complicated to understand them. When in need for help, look for younger people; they are more likely to know some English.

- [dead link] Ethnographic museum (ეთნოგრაფიული მუზეუმი). The building represents an old wooden house with ornaments. There are Gurian characteristic facilities:, barn, Oda-house, wine cellar exhibited.
- 1 Dvabzu church (დვაბზუს ეკლესია). with six-meter high stone walls built from the 4th century. It is located on the left side of river Bakhvistskali
